High Court Orders Arrest of Duo Occupying Former Pub in Liberties, Dublin
The High Court has issued an order for the arrest of two men who were occupying a former pub in the Liberties area of Dublin. The men had previously stated a 'moral duty' to acquire the vacant building due to the ongoing homeless crisis.
